Leapmotor Unveils New B10 SUV at Paris Motor Show

Leapmotor, a company partnered with Stellantis, has revealed its new B10 SUV at the Paris motor show, as reported by German news agency dpa.

The B10 is a C-segment SUV that aims to compete with cars like the Jeep Avenger and new Mini Aceman. It is one of several new models to come from Leapmotor, joining the T03, C10, and C16 in the firm’s portfolio.

Overview of the B10

Underneath its skin, the B10 will sit on the 3.5 architecture platform, which allows the vehicle to be fitted with advanced driver safety systems and a customizable digital cockpit. However, details on the battery pack, performance figures, and electric range of the car have yet to be revealed.

Leapmotor’s Global Expansion

The Paris motor show is a significant event for Leapmotor, marking the start of its global expansion. Since September 23, the company has begun sales in Europe with a total of 200 dealers across 13 countries. Leapmotor aims to expand its dealership network to around 500 by the end of 2025, with four new models being introduced to the market. The company’s goal is to deliver low-cost electric vehicles to consumers.

"Leapmotor International may be a start-up, but it’s a start-up with two incredibly strong parents," says Tianshu Xin, chief executive of Leapmotor International. "One brings innovation and competitive pricing to the table, while the other – through our partnership with Stellantis – offers powerful global resources and an unmatched service infrastructure. Together, we are able to offer consumers products like the B10, which combine cutting-edge technology with affordability."
